Hands-On: ‘The Big Table’ – A Quirky Educational App That Encourages Experimentation
Successfully combining educational value with an entertaining, playful presentation, The Big Table is a VR laboratory that teaches many fundamental chemistry concepts, aimed at students aged 13 to 17. The app recently launched on Gear VR and Oculus Rift.

Hands-on: ‘Megalith’ is a Promising First-person MOBA Brawler Landing First on PSVR
Megalith is an upcoming first-person arena brawler from Disruptive Games which puts you in MOBA-style combat against other heroes as you—and your pint-sized minions—sally forth to destroy the other team's base.
